Web31 mei 2024 · Español. Lymphopenia (also called lymphocytopenia) is a disorder in which your blood doesn’t have enough white blood cells called lymphocytes. Lymphocytes play a protective role in your immune system. There are three types of lymphocytes. All lymphocytes help protect you from infection, but they have different functions.
